Output fa8a402693229b46b3de07618bb79e606e9d76ee5a4361f709e437e7ce4eba58:1

value
743489
script pubkey
OP_0 OP_PUSHBYTES_20 8596c5e43b102a4c75a141acb2a93842fa6842b3
address
bc1qsktvtepmzq4ycadpgxkt92fcgtaxss4nd9c73c
transaction
fa8a402693229b46b3de07618bb79e606e9d76ee5a4361f709e437e7ce4eba58
confirmations
364607
spent
true